Van Drivers with warehouse duties
for a leading distributor of light and commercial vehicle parts, serving over 35,000 repairers across the UK & Ireland. Location:
Exeter
Working Hours: Monday to Friday: 08:30–17:30
Two Saturdays per month: 08:00–12:00
Pay Rate:
£12.71 per hour
Contract Type:
Temp to Perm Role Overview:
This is a dual-role position involving van deliveries and warehouse tasks such as picking and packing. You'll be part of a fast-paced logistics team ensuring accurate order handling and timely deliveries. ?
Requirements: Full UK Driving Licence (essential)
Previous van driving experience required
Comfortable with manual handling and lifting up to 25kg
Reliable, punctual, and flexible with working hours
Team player with good communication skills

The UK has now left the European Union. Any EU, EEA or Swiss citizens living in the UK that wish to remain in the UK post Brexit need to apply to the EU Settlement Scheme. Although the closing date for applications was 30th Jun 2021, if you have not yet applied but believe that you would qualify under the EU Settlement Scheme, the Home Office have confirmed that they will consider late applications.
